A Life Marked by Loss

Keanu Reeves’ life has been no stranger to tragedy. Born in Beirut, Lebanon, in 1964, he faced a turbulent childhood. His father abandoned the family when Keanu was just three, leaving him to grow up with a sense of absence that would linger. As a young man, he moved to Toronto, Canada, where he pursued acting, eventually becoming a household name. But success came at a cost. In 1993, his best friend, actor River Phoenix, died of a drug overdose, a loss that shook Reeves to his core. The pain deepened in 1999 when his girlfriend, Jennifer Syme, gave birth to their stillborn daughter, Ava. The couple’s grief strained their relationship, and in 2001, Syme died in a tragic car accident. These losses left scars that never fully healed, shaping Reeves into a man who guards his heart closely.

Alexandra Grant: A Beacon of Hope

Enter Alexandra Grant, the woman who changed everything. A visual artist known for her work in painting and sculpture, Grant met Reeves in 2011 while collaborating on his book Ode to Happiness, which she illustrated. Their partnership blossomed into a deep friendship, rooted in mutual respect and shared creativity. By 2019, they confirmed their romantic relationship, stepping out hand-in-hand at a Los Angeles art gala.
